Philanthropic foundations

QC-16-3_GracePatersonPortrait.jpg

This exhibit looks at the philanthropic principles behind the establishment of the Glasgow School of Cookery in 1875.  It shows the work of the Glasgow School and the West End School of Cookery and their merger to become the Glasgow and West of Scotland College of Domestic Science.

Reaching the public

QC-17-1-1_GCB_NewRevised1951_dust jacket.jpg

This exhibit looks at the ways in which the College shared its expertise to help the wider public.  Through lectures, exhibitions, publications and offering services to help the needy, the staff and students helped educate the public on a range of issues from healthy eating to raising awareness of the importance of domestic economy.
